Key statistics

Chord Energy Corp. (CHRD) statistics: revenue, profit & scale

The headline figures, each with its date. Every row carries its own link — cite it straight from here.

  • Chord Energy Corp. has a market value of $8.3B and an enterprise value of $9.2B.

  • Revenue in the twelve months to 30 June 2026: $6.3B. The latest quarter grew 84.1% year on year.

  • Net income over the same four quarters: $848.3M, a 13.4% net margin.

  • Diluted earnings per share, trailing twelve months: $14.92.

  • Free cash flow in the twelve months to 30 June 2026: $1.2B, after $1.4B of capital spending.

  • Chord Energy Corp. spent $308.5M on share buybacks and $296.6M on dividends in the twelve months to 30 June 2026.

  • Shares outstanding: 55.2M.

  • Trailing P/E: 10.3×; forward P/E: 10.3× — the forward figure prices analyst consensus estimates, not reported earnings.

  • Forward dividend yield: 3.42%, paying out 35% of earnings.

  • Chord Energy Corp. employs 676 people $9.3M of revenue per employee.

What is the CHRD stock forecast for 2030?

No analyst covering Chord Energy Corp. publishes a 2030 price target — Wall Street targets run 12 to 18 months out. Sites quoting a 2030 price for CHRD are extrapolating price history, which says nothing about the business. The furthest attributed numbers are the current analyst targets: $130 to $217 over the next 12 months.

Company

About Chord Energy Corp.

Chord Energy Corporation is an independent oil and gas exploration and production company focused on acquiring, developing, and producing crude oil, natural gas liquids, and natural gas. The company’s core operations are centered in the Williston Basin, where it manages unconventional onshore assets and uses horizontal drilling and hydraulic stimulation to develop its resource base. Chord Energy also conducts limited non-operated interests in other basins while maintaining a business model built around efficient field development and disciplined reservoir management. Its production is sold into wholesale energy markets through customers with access to pipeline and rail infrastructure. Headquartered in Houston, Texas, Chord Energy serves as a significant upstream producer in the U.S. energy market, supporting supply for refiners, marketers, and other industrial buyers.
